customer

/ˈkʌstəmə(r)/

A customer is a person or organization that buys goods or services from a store or business. It describes the person who pays for an item at the moment of sale.

常见搭配

customer service support provided to people who buy products
regular customer a person who shops at the same place often
potential customer someone who might buy something in the future
customer satisfaction how happy a buyer is with a product or service
loyal customer a person who continues to buy from the same company

常用短语

The customer is always right

A motto suggesting that staff should always agree with buyers

tough customer

a person who is difficult to deal with or satisfy

customer-facing

dealing directly with people who buy goods

容易混淆的词

customer vs client

A customer usually buys physical goods from a shop, while a client pays for professional services from a lawyer or accountant.

customer vs consumer

The customer is the person who buys the product, but the consumer is the one who actually uses it.

使用说明

Use 'customer' when talking about retail environments like supermarkets, clothing stores, or fast-food restaurants.

⚠️

常见错误

Learners often use 'client' for simple transactions; remember to use 'customer' for shops and 'client' for professional services.

词源

Originates from the Middle English word 'custumer', meaning someone who follows a 'custom' or habitual practice of buying.

语法模式

Countable noun: one customer, two customers Often used as a compound noun (e.g., customer base, customer care)
